Passion flower (Passiflora 'Venus'). The passion flower is a tropical climbing plant that is native to South America. The flower consists of white petals and off-white sepals crowned with purple corona filaments. In the centre are the reproductive parts of the plant. The male parts are at the bottom,with the female parts on top. There are five male stamens,which consist of a stalk-like filament and a pollen-bearing anther. Above these is the pale green round ovary,which is topped by three styles,which all end in a stigma | |
